What is "proof of due notice of meeting" in an organization's bylaws?
Our bylaws note we have to have this or "waivers thereof," for our annual meeting but what constitutes proof of due notice?
Additional Details
Who am I notifying - the Board members? The public? And how much notice am I supposed to give?
